BiblioLabs, LLC is a hybrid media-technology company based in Charleston, South Carolina. We work with leading information organizations around the world to curate and commercially distribute historical and academic content. To that end we have built a powerful and scalable content discovery, composition, enhancement and distribution platform.
We curate and publish our own digital content under our BiblioLife imprint and also power multi-media Apps for some of the world’s leading cultural institutions. In Summer 2012 we will launch BiblioBoard a free consumer App for iPad. BiblioBoard is the unified interface where curators will meet readers across tens of thousands of books, articles and images within hundreds of curated niche Apps. The British Library 19th Century Historical Collection App Wins Prestigious Publishing Innovation Award
At the opening of the Digital Book World Conference in New York City on January 23rd, the British Library, together with technology partner, BiblioLabs, LLC, was awarded the prestigious Publishing Innovation Award (PIA) for their British Library 19th Century Historical Collection iPad App. The App, released in August last year to rave reviews from both critics and consumers, offers seamless, cloud-based access to more than 45,000 historical works from the British Library, spanning 21 thematic collections.
The Publishing Innovation Awards were established to honor outstanding digital products that enrich and delight readers. The British Library 19th Century Historical Collection App was named the 2012 Winner in the Reference/Academic category.
